“This will be the experience of a lifetime”

National Award-winning actor Arifin Shuvoo entered the world of showbiz with television, making his way to the silver screen with hits like "Dhaka Attack" (2017) and "Shapludu" (2018), among many other memorable hits.
The actor is set to portray the Father of the Nation, Bangabandhu Sheikh Mujibur Rahman in his biopic. In a candid chat with The Daily Star, the actor talks about his preparations for the role, his experience and his expectations.
How are you preparing yourself for portraying the Father of the Nation, Bangabandhu Sheikh Mujibur Rahman?
I was cast in this role in February 2019 and since then, I have prepared for this every day. I watched a lot of documentaries and films on our great leader, and viewed his archived video clips. Reading different research-based books and conversing with the writers of such pieces has also helped me understand him a lot.
We were supposed to start shooting, but it was halted due to the coronavirus pandemic. Nevertheless, the long break has given me more time to perfectly understand the character of Bangabandhu Sheikh Mujibur Rahman.
How do you feel about this opportunity?
Being a Bangladeshi, it is a matter of great pride and honour from my side. As an artiste, it is my responsibility to do justice to his legacy, and I will give it my all. Even though at times, there is a lot of anxiety and pressure, I am trying to keep calm. This will be the experience of a lifetime, and I want to enjoy it to the fullest. Shyam Benegal is a perfectionist, and I wish to deliver in accordance with his expectations. The performance I put up is all that matters now, and that's what I have been focusing on.
Tell us a bit about your recent conversation with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ina.
This has been one of the most memorable incidents of my life. She gave me a lot of insight on her father, Bangabandhu Sheikh Mujibur Rahman's character, things I would have only known from someone very close to his heart. This experience has left a mark in my heart for all eternity. She gave me her blessings to succeed in this challenging portrayal.
When do you plan to begin shooting for this project?
We will be travelling to Mumbai, India on January 19 and plan to start from January 25. This role will remain a milestone in my career.
